Dark Souls III Expansion the Ringed City Announced for PS4,Xbox One and PC

By Keith MitchellJanuary 23, 2017

Here we go, this is what I needed to start the day. The second DLC expansion for Dark Souls III has finally been announced. Thankfully, this time it doesn’t seem like we’re getting a PVP based expansion. Dark Souls III: The Ringed City will have players chasing after a new character, the Slave Knight. From the information provided, it seems this will extend the original story of the Dark Soul III story.

Gael, the Slave Knight, who apparently is looking for the Dark Soul of humanity, will stop at nothing to accomplish its goal. You may remember this fellow from Dark Souls III: Ashes of Ariandel, he’s the one who got you snatched away. Along the way, players can expect to encounter ancient beasts, new characters, as well as stumble across new magics, armors, weapons and of course a long lost city. Sounds like my kind of fun.

The Dark Souls III: The Ringed City DLC will cost $14.99 and will be released on March 28, 2017 for PS4, Xbox One and PC.
